Fifty isolates of Crinipellis perniciosa originating from Theobroma cacao, Heteropterys acutifolia and Solanum lycocarpum, from six states within Brazil, were characterized through ERIC-PCR, representing the first application of this method for molecular characterization within C. perniciosa. Phenetic analysis of banding patterns revealed a separation of isolates on the basis of host of origin, with T. cacao-derived isolates showing only a 0·2 similarity level to a cluster comprising the isolates from H. acutifolia and S. lycocarpum. Considerable intraspecific variability was observed within C. perniciosa isolates from T. cacao, with distinct groups observed correlating with geographical origin. Given that a number of isolates from T. cacao from the Amazon region grouped with isolates from Bahia state, this work discusses the possibility that current C. perniciosa populations pathogenic on T. cacao in Bahia originated from the Amazon region, rather than from alternative host plants.
